Defending champions Calicut FC became the first team to enter the semifinals of the second season of Super League Kerala with a 3-1 win against 10-man Malappuram FC at the EMS Corporation Stadium in Kozhikode on Monday.

With their fifth win of the campaign, Calicut have 17 points from eight matches, enough to confirm a spot in the last-four. Malappuram are fourth on 10 points, ahead of fifth-placed Kannur Warriors only by goal difference.

Calicut found two late goals to win the match, with Muhammed Ajsal scoring in the 88th minute and Federico Boasso adding a third on 90+2.

Jonathan Pereyra had put the hosts ahead in the 12th minute, and Malappuram were reduced to 10 men in the 54th minute when Gani Ahmmed received a second yellow.

Malappuram came alive in the final quarter, with Aitor Aldalur getting the equaliser with a powerful freekick. But the hosts prevailed in the dying moments.

Result: Calicut 3 (Jonathan Pereyra 12, Muhammed Ajsal 88, Federico Boasso 90+2) bt Malappuram 1 (Aitor Aldalur 80)
